Transaction 64aab4411e7d16786ddf4eb999e2395c620ba84de230f2312c81ffeaeac56385
1 Input
1 Output
-
64aab4411e7d16786ddf4eb999e2395c620ba84de230f2312c81ffeaeac56385:0
- value
- 4962200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 546416edf73b6a1b644598cd151a36101b3ac6bb OP_EQUAL
- address
- 39PEb17AvKo1Wh1zH19ymocgRu4v3qKGGz